Introduction of the VQ35 Engine
Developed as part of Nissan's VQ engine household, the VQ35 engine is a 3.5-liter V6 powerplant that has actually garnered a track record for its balance of efficiency and performance. Introduced in the very early 2000s, this engine has been utilized in numerous Nissan and Infiniti models, including the Murano, Altima, and 350Z. Its layout incorporates an aluminum alloy block and DOHC (Dual Expenses Camshaft) arrangement, which add to its lightweight and portable nature.
The VQ35 engine features a 60-degree V-angle and uses variable valve timing innovation, improving both power shipment and fuel efficiency. With a maximum result normally around 280 horse power and 270 lb-ft of torque, it gives ample performance for a mid-sized SUV. The engine is also understood for its smooth procedure and reasonably low sound degrees, making it ideal for family-oriented cars like the Murano.

Usual Concerns
While the VQ35 engine is commemorated for its general Dependability, it is not without its share of common problems that proprietors may run into. One frequent worry involves the engine's oil consumption. Numerous VQ35 owners report too much oil burning, which can cause low oil degrees and possible engine damages otherwise resolved quickly.
One more issue refers to the timing chain. vq35. The VQ35 is outfitted with a timing chain rather than a belt, which typically requires less upkeep, some owners have actually experienced chain stretch and connected rattling sounds, specifically in older designs. This can bring about serious engine damages if not identified early
Furthermore, the engine might struggle with coolant leakages, particularly at the consumption manifold. Such leaks can result in Continued overheating and succeeding engine failure otherwise taken care of.
